Form not shown with conditional logic within WP theme but in preview

  1. Pibo
    Member

    Hello,

    I have WPML, Gravity Forms updated, etc. and the Nocturnal WP theme from ThemeForest.

    The form with conditional logic is working on the preview, but it is not shown within the theme. Here is the link: http://bit.ly/J6XTTq

    If the form has deactivated conditional logic, it is displayed already.

    Do you know a solution for this issue?

  2. TIA - your theme is running a super-old version of jQuery as seen in this Screenshot. The latest version of GF requires the most recent release of jQuery to function, especially with conditional logic enabled. You will need to make sure your theme is loading the most recent version of jQuery.

  3. David Peralty

    The theme uses JQuery 1.5.1 and WordPress comes with JQuery version 1.7.1 and that's what Gravity Forms expects to see. you'll either need to update your theme to pull the right version of JQuery or contact the theme author about updating their theme.
